Java学习之内存的基本结构
2018-03-23 18:00
183 查看
看视频学习记录,若理解有错,请指正,谢谢!
底层内存结构主要分为:栈,堆,静态域,常量池
栈(stack):存放局部变量,对象的引用;
堆(heap):存放new出来的对象;
静态域:存放静态变量(由static修饰);
常量池:一般存放字符串常量和基本类型常量;
大致上的分布图。
先上一段代码
底层内存结构主要分为:栈,堆,静态域,常量池
栈(stack):存放局部变量,对象的引用;
堆(heap):存放new出来的对象;
静态域:存放静态变量(由static修饰);
常量池:一般存放字符串常量和基本类型常量;
大致上的分布图。
先上一段代码
相关文章推荐
- JVM学习笔记(1、 基本结构;2、Java代码编译和执行的整个过程3、内存管理和垃圾回收 4、 内存调优 )
- Java内存结构学习总结
- java学习之旅52--数组_数组基本概念_内存分析
- Core Java学习笔记摘录系列--第3章 Java的基本程序设计结构
- Java学习日记-2.3 基本数据类型和对象所占内存空间大小
- 黑马程序员--Java基础学习笔记之抽象类和接口、内存结构分析、Java APIs
- Java学习——Java基本的程序设计结构笔记(一)
- JAVA学习笔记-JAVA程序的基本结构
- java学习之路 之 基本语法-程序流程控制-循环结构-for 循环练习题
- java之jvm学习笔记十三(jvm基本结构)
- Java 学习笔记 (13) - 基本内存分析 和 垃圾回收机制
- java学习之路 之 基本语法-程序流程控制-循环结构-嵌套循环练习题
- JVM学习笔记(1、 基本结构;2、Java代码编译和执行的整个过程3、内存管理和垃圾回收 4、 内存调优 )
- java学习笔记-基本程序设计结构
- Java核心技术(第8版)学习笔记_基本的程序设计结构
- Java学习——Java基本的程序设计结构笔记(一)
- JAVA学习笔记-基本程序设计结构
- java之jvm学习笔记十三(jvm基本结构)
- Java核心技术学习笔记之一:Java的基本程序设计结构
- 重新学习Java——Java基本的程序设计结构(二)